a meeting in Marion sponsored by wy gy : the Rotary, Kiwanis, Lions and Ex- y/ ‘American change Clubs. Beauty’ os * |A correspondent in Tokyo 11} Rg vk @ 75 50 years, Mr. Young also is general Lox) :

manager of the Japan Advertiser, an American daily, and adviser to a Japanese newspaper. | 1 Before going to Japan, Mr. Young covered assignments in Europe and. in Africa. He was private secretary to the late E. W. Scripps, 9 founder of the Scripps-Howard newspapers, and was with the publisher when he died in 1926,
